Not On Label - Tape
Spain & France, 2025
Experimental / Modern Classical / Free Music
Split mixtape by Office PSR's Tom Val (Les Disques Omnison) and friend Pablo Mirón from Miradasvacas fame and Ediciones Fontenebro (his beautiful Madrid-based archival label). 2 x 45 min dives into their musical influences and, in Tom's own words, their collection of "outsider psycheographic music". Highly recommended, of course!
Quite a bewitching couple of mixes: obscure, and free in a way that allows the two musicians to mesh Jordi Savall with obscure handbell covers, Lamonte Young's drones and unidentifiable field recordings seamlessly. A travelogue that takes us through Europe's desolate landscapes, leaving Antwerp's gargantuan station by train, passing by empty plains, gothic bell-towers and Charleroi's steel-mill, eventually reaching places as opaque and historically dense as those recalled by Austerlitz and other W.G. Sebald's characters. The outcome is rather bleak, but shouldn't it be, as the Old Continent looks more and more like its fantasy depictions in Lars Von Trier's early Europa Trilogy?
